Did you know that wood is basically very hygienic to use? It has naturally antibacterial properties, so germs and bacteria don't stand a chance. In addition, it absorbs virtually no odours or aromas!

After use, you can simply rinse it briefly under running water with a mild dishwashing liquid. The only important thing is that it dries well afterwards. We recommend rubbing the wood with a neutral oil from time to time - we prefer to use odourless rapeseed oil, it ensures that water is not absorbed so quickly by the wood, that colouring food does not leave stains so quickly and that the wood retains its original colour.

Cleaning Baking tools made of wood or with wooden handles should be cleaned by hand. Use warm water, a mild detergent and a soft cloth or sponge. Avoid soaking in water as this could damage the wood. Wooden baking tools are not dishwasher-safe. Dry the products carefully immediately after cleaning to avoid cracks or deformation. To care for the wood, you can occasionally rub it with a little cooking oil to protect the natural surface and prolong its life. Store the baking tools in a dry place and avoid direct sunlight or high humidity to keep the wood in the best condition.
